USAID Energizes Uzbekistan’s First Green Hydrogen Hub

by NEWSROOM


February 29, 2024, Tashkent, Uzbekistan –Today, the United States Agency for International

Development (USAID) introduced a new initiative to support Uzbekistan’s clean energy objectives – the development of a Green Hydrogen Hub. Green hydrogen is defined as hydrogen energy developed by using renewable energy resources. Hydrogen is emerging as one of the leading options for storing and potentially transporting energy from renewables over long distances.
